Combine the potatoes, flour (starting with ⅓ cup), salt, and pepper in a small mixing bowl. Lightly mix with a spoon to combine.
Make a well in the center of the mixture, crack an egg into the well, and whisk, then fold it into the potato mixture.
Gently stir in the chives.
Add more flour to the mixture as needed, so that it can be easily formed into patties. Be careful not to use too much flour.
Melt the butter in a skillet over medium heat.
Form 4 patties with the potato mixture and place them into the skillet, cooking the patties until golden brown on each side, about 5 to 7 minutes per side.
